Loe, Hono, Betay
Loe, Hono, Betay is a story-driven visual novel that puts drama, romance, and betrayal at the center of every scene. Instead of relying on fast-paced action or complex mechanics, this application focuses on dialogue choices and character relationships. Each episode feels like a small TV drama, where your decisions shape how trust and loyalty develop between the main cast. The game stands out because it prioritizes emotional storytelling over gameplay complexity, making it a solid choice for anyone who enjoys narrative-heavy experiences. Whether you are commuting or relaxing at home, the episode format lets you play in short sessions without losing the thread of the story.

Key Features
The branching story paths in Loe, Hono, Betay allow you to influence conversations and relationships through simple tap controls. Each decision can shift the direction of the narrative, encouraging multiple playthroughs to explore alternate outcomes. The character-driven drama revolves around a small cast with distinct personalities, secrets, and emotional baggage. Love, loyalty, and betrayal are woven into the dialogue, giving every scene a layer of tension. The episode-based structure means you can finish a chapter in one sitting, then pick up later without feeling lost. Replay value is high, since different choices open up new scenes and reactions.
Guide and Usage Tips
Start by reading through the opening scenes carefully, as early choices set the tone for your relationships. When a decision prompt appears, take a moment to consider how each response might affect the characters around you. Pay attention to subtle shifts in dialogue or character expressions, since these hints can reveal hidden motives. If you are curious about how a different path plays out, replay earlier episodes and experiment with bolder or more cautious replies. The game works well on most Android devices, but closing background apps can help avoid lag during longer conversation sequences. For the best experience, use headphones to catch the emotional nuances in the voice acting and sound design.
